Résumé
When someone we love leaves this world, we're often left standing at the threshold between grief and goodbye, searching for words that feel impossible to find. Our hearts overflow with everything we wish we'd said, yet our mouths go dry when it's time to speak. In those sacred moments when family and friends gather to honor a life, the right words can become a bridge between sorrow and healing, a final gift of love that echoes long after the service ends."Final Words" understands that every relationship is unique, every loss cuts differently, and every goodbye deserves its own voice.
Whether you're honoring the parent who shaped your world, the child whose time was heartbreakingly brief, the friend who knew your soul, or the mentor who changed your path, this book walks beside you through the tender work of finding words worthy of their memory. Inside these pages, you'll discover compassionate guidance for crafting eulogies that honor mothers and fathers, husbands and wives, siblings and grandparents, friends and mentors.
You'll find understanding for the most difficult goodbyes, those shadowed by sudden loss, long illness, suicide, addiction, or estrangement. No relationship is forgotten here, from the bonds of blood to the families we choose, from beloved pets to precious lives we never got to hold. This isn't just a book about death. It's about love made visible through words, about transforming the chaos of grief into something beautiful and true.
It's about standing up when your legs feel weak and your voice trembles, knowing that what you say matters, that these final words will comfort those who remain and honor the irreplaceable person who has gone. When the moment comes to say goodbye, you won't have to face it alone.
